These reflect the main Government priorities, many of which will bemeasured by the National Indicator Set and delivered locally by <strong>Local</strong>Authorities and partner organisations. The national PSA’s arecategorised under the themes of sustainable growth and prosperity,fairness and opportunity for all, stronger communities and a betterquality of life, and a more secure, fair and environmentally sustainableworld.The national PSA’s relevant to <strong>Local</strong> Authorities and partners are:-Sustainable Growth and Prosperity• PSA 2 – Improve the skills of the population, on the way to ensuringa world-class skills base by 2020.• PSA 5 – Deliver reliable and efficient transport networks thatsupport growth.Fairness and Opportunity for All• PSA 8 – Maximise employment opportunity for all.• PSA 9 – Halve the number of children in poverty by 2010-11, on theway to eradicating child poverty by 2020.• PSA 10 – Raise the educational achievement of all children andyoung people.• PSA 11 – Narrow the gap in educational achievement betweenchildren from low income and disadvantaged backgrounds and theirpeers.• PSA 12 – Improve the health and wellbeing of children and youngpeople.• PSA 13 – Improve children and young people’s safety.• PSA 14 – Increase the number of children and young people on thepath to success.• PSA 15 – Address the disadvantage that individuals experiencedbecause of their gender, race, disability, age, sexual orientation,religion or belief.• PSA 16 – Increase the proportion of socially excluded adults insettled accommodation and employment, education or training.• PSA 17 – Tackle poverty and promote greater independence andwellbeing in later life.Stronger Communities and a Better Quality of Life• PSA 18 – Promote better health and wellbeing for all.• PSA 19 – Ensure better care for all.• PSA 20 – Increase long term housing supply and affordability.• PSA <strong>21</strong> – Build more cohesive, empowered and activecommunities.• PSA 23 – Make communities safer.• PSA 25 – Reduce the harm caused by alcohol and drugs.12Introduction Barnsley’s <strong>Local</strong> <strong>Area</strong> <strong>Agreement</strong> <strong>2008</strong>-11
